Navigating the world of medications can be challenging, especially when determining between prescription and over-the-counter options. Prescription pharmaceuticals are formulated to treat specific medical conditions and require a prescription from a authorized healthcare expert. These medications undergo rigorous testing and are monitored by government agencies to ensure safety.

On the other hand, over-the-counter medications are purchasable without a authorization and are intended to alleviate common disorders. These preparations undergo simplified testing and control, making them more readily accessible to the population.

Personalized Medication Preparation: The Power of Compounding Pharmacy

Compounding pharmacy is a specialized field of pharmacy that involves creating custom medications tailored to patient needs. Unlike traditional pharmacies that dispense pre-made medications, compounding pharmacies mix ingredients to create personalized formulations based on a doctor's prescription. This allows for greater flexibility in addressing various medical conditions. Compounding pharmacies can synthesize medications in different dosages, such as creams, gels, capsules, and even liquid solutions. They also accommodate patients with allergies or sensitivities to certain ingredients in commercially available medications.
